Join us for an enriching edWeb podcast that explores an evidence-based approach to literacy instruction, integrating multiple modalities for optimal learning outcomes. Our expert presenters guide you through a dynamic and blended methodology designed to seamlessly infuse the Science of Reading into developmentally appropriate early learning experiences.

In this enlightening session, listeners:

  • Gain a deep understanding of the foundational principles behind the Science of Reading and how they can be applied effectively in early learning environments
  • Explore a diverse range of strategies and techniques that harness the power of various sensory modalities to enhance literacy skills among young learners
  • Learn how to seamlessly integrate evidence-based practices into your teaching repertoire, ensuring that your instruction aligns with the latest research in literacy education
  • Acquire insights into tailoring literacy instruction to meet the unique developmental needs of early learners, promoting a supportive and engaging educational experience
  • Leave with actionable insights and tools to empower young readers with the critical literacy skills necessary for lifelong success

This session equips you with knowledge and strategies, enabling you to create a literacy-rich environment that nurtures early learners’ reading and language development. This edWeb podcast is of interest to PreK-3 teachers, early childhood directors and leaders, Head Start program administrators, and curriculum and instruction directors and specialists.
